Transaction 96740f6561291e28dee2613761593d19e6f4a8a2c26e925e2b658bf8d29498aa

1 Input
2 Outputs
  • 96740f6561291e28dee2613761593d19e6f4a8a2c26e925e2b658bf8d29498aa:0
  • value  64827807
    address  3NKxCammCc3BVi7H4yMXCfXowvPrJ6coGy
  • 96740f6561291e28dee2613761593d19e6f4a8a2c26e925e2b658bf8d29498aa:1
  • value  10000000
    address  3DmfqJtHsVedd5LCREeiXvqhkZrX5AjWth